Wrapping a CT is going to be extremely cheap for DIY and significantly less than similar sized SUV's at a shop because most of the labor goes into curves. No curves on CT to deal with!

You can get really high quality, gorgeous wraps for about $2k or less and do a DIY wrap. This is the easiest vehicle to wrap in the world, hands down. If you can install wallpaper to any degree, you can wrap a CT blindfolded.
